Financial Performance - For Q3 FY2026, total revenue was approximately $251 million, consistent with the same period last fiscal year, and diluted earnings per share totaled $1, reflecting a 6% year-over-year increase [5][16] - For the first nine months of FY2026, revenue was approximately $656 million, a 6% year-over-year increase, with diluted earnings per share of $1.96, up 15% from $1.70 in the prior year [5][20] - Gross profit margin was 82.8% in Q3, consistent with the prior year, while operating margin increased to 35.9% from 35.6% year-over-year [19][20] Business Line Performance - Service assurance revenue increased approximately 5% year-over-year for the first nine months, driven by growth in enterprise customer verticals, particularly from government-related spending [6][20] - Cybersecurity revenue grew 9% year-over-year during the same period, reflecting strong demand in response to a complex cyber threat landscape [8][20] - Product revenue for Q3 was $121.7 million, down from $128.2 million last year, while service revenue increased 4.1% to $129 million [16][20] Market Insights - The U.S. represented 57% of total revenue, while international markets accounted for 43% during the first nine months of FY2026 [21] - The enterprise customer vertical accounted for approximately 58% of total revenue, with a 9.4% growth, while service provider vertical revenue grew 2.2% [20][21] Company Strategy and Industry Competition - The company is focused on product innovation, returning to annual revenue growth, and enhancing margins through disciplined cost management [13][14] - The competitive landscape in the service provider sector is characterized by price pressures and budget constraints, particularly in the context of 5G initiatives [43][44] Management Commentary on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ed cautious optimism regarding demand signals, noting potential supply chain challenges that could affect order timing [26][27] - The company raised its revenue outlook for FY2026 to a range of $835 million to $870 million, reflecting solid execution and continued demand for its solutions [23][24] Other Important Information - NETSCOUT's Omnis Cyber Intelligence was recognized as a 2025 CyberSecured Award Winner, highlighting its advanced capabilities in network security [9] - The company ended Q3 FY2026 with $586.2 million in cash and cash equivalents, representing an increase of $93.7 million since the end of FY2025 [21] Q&A Session Summary Question: Can you comment on demand trends and if they are improving? - Management noted that demand signals are similar or improving, but supply chain challenges could delay order timing [26][27] Question: Can you quantify the pull-ins this quarter? - Approximately $15 million in pull-ins were noted, impacting both product and service revenue [28] Question: How did customer budgets work in pulling orders from one quarter to another? - Customers often pull orders based on their fiscal year-end budgets, which can lead to demand in one quarter that reflects budget utilization from another [33][35] Question: What is driving the service assurance business? - The service assurance business is seeing growth from traditional service triage and AI use cases, with Smart Data being a key differentiator [36][37] Question: How is the supply chain impacting product growth margins? - Management indicated that while supply chain issues could affect timing, they do not significantly impact margins due to the software-centric nature of the business [46][48]
